
The governance team, project team, and project implementing partners of Punya Foundation met on 21 May 2026 to review the progress of the cancer project aimed at improving cancer care equity and increasing cancer screening uptake among Nepali-speaking migrant communities in Australia. The project is funded by the Australian Government through Cancer Australia under the Supporting People with Cancer Grant Program.
The meeting reviewed completed community sessions, implementation progress, and future activity dates. South Australia has successfully completed its sessions with positive community feedback, while additional sessions are planned in Queensland, Tasmania, and Victoria.
The team also appraised the completion of bilingual podcasts and educational materials. A focus group discussion will be organised as part of the final stage of the project.
